Output 303565b58ecf423e30a9dea580b71a141e972d258077061dbe014e86ac8904e3:1

value
345201894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ae5b518740a50d7f100ead54cf70899d3b53c733 OP_EQUAL
address
3Havtqidk8WsbyJtzT7sS9dwteP9HapLya
transaction
303565b58ecf423e30a9dea580b71a141e972d258077061dbe014e86ac8904e3
spent
true